| career roles | key responsibilities |
|---|---|
| remediation project manager | plan and oversee remediation projects ensure timely completion of tasks manage budgets and resources |
| environmental compliance specialist | monitor compliance with regulations conduct audits and inspections prepare compliance reports |
| site remediation engineer | design remediation strategies supervise on-site activities evaluate remediation effectiveness |
| waste management consultant | develop waste management plans advise on sustainable practices ensure regulatory adherence |
| environmental health and safety officer | implement safety protocols conduct risk assessments train staff on safety procedures |
| remediation technology specialist | research and recommend technologies optimize remediation processes troubleshoot technical issues |
| environmental data analyst | collect and analyze environmental data prepare detailed reports support decision-making processes |
